Chris Duhon was replaced by Nate Robinsonas the starting point guard last week, but that is going to changeagain. Duhon met with Knicks head coach Mike D'Antoni on Saturday andhe'll probably be given the starting role again beginning Tuesdayagainst Sacramento.

"It was typical coach-talking-to-his-captain type talk, trying tosee what we could do to get this team back to where we were," Duhontold New York Post."What I see we could do differently, what he and I need to do better.There was a lot of brain-storming trying to find solutions."

According to the newspaper, D'Antoni thinks Robinson is better suited as a shooting guard off the bench.
